What is a Psychiatrist?
A psychiatrist is a clinically experienced medical professional concentrating on identifying, treating, and preventing mental health conditions. Unlike psychologists, who concentrate on talk therapy, psychiatrists can recommend medication and provide a combination of medical and healing techniques to treatment.

In the UK, there are several types of psychiatrists based on their locations of know-how:
Type of PsychiatristDescriptionGeneral Adult PsychiatristDeals with a variety of mental health concerns in grownups.Kid and Adolescent PsychiatristFocuses on young people and associated issues.Psychiatrist for the ElderlyConcentrate on mental health issues in older populations.Dependency PsychiatristOffers with substance abuse and dependency therapies.Forensic PsychiatristFunctions within the legal system, addressing mental health in criminal cases.Tips for Effective Communication
